Don't watch highlight videos,  
Section331 : 1/8/2018 11:06 am : link
almost any QB is going to look good, that is the point of them. You can find edited YouTube videos on most top QB's to show all of the QB's passing plays in a game - good and bad.

I watched a video of Logan Woodside's game against Miami in 2016, and I was really impressed. Toledo had a significant talent gap, but he showed good poise in the pocket, even as it often fell apart around him. Very good arm, can make all the throws. He made a number of beautiful deep throws, most of which were dropped by his WR's.

The downside, Toledo plays a spread, so he doesn't have much (any?) experience playing under center, and he is a little smallish. 6'2, and a little skinny. He could definitely beef up his legs, but he would be a great project if the Giants decide not to go QB in rd 1.
